#414b14 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#414b14 is composed of 25.5% red, 29.4%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.3%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 70.9 degrees, a saturation of 57.9% and a lightness of 18.6%. #414b14 color hex could be obtained by blending #829628 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#414b14 color description : Very dark yellow [Olive tone].
#414b14 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#414b14 has RGB values of R:65, G:75,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 4279060.

Shades and Tints of #414b14
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0d03 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#414b14
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#31312e is the less saturated color, while #4d5d02 is the most saturated one.
